There are now Little Free Libraries on all seven continents. The first Little Free Library in Antarctica was established a few years ago at the South Pole by Russell Schnell. Schnell—an atmospheric scientist for the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ration and co-recipient of the 2007 Nobel Peace Prize for his work on the International Panel on Climate Change—built the Little Free Library at his home in Boulder, Colorado, in November then shipped it to the South Pole, where he had previously traveled for work.
